Biden and Qatari Leader Discuss Hostage Situation and Humanitarian Aid
TL;DR Summary
President Biden spoke with Amir Sheikh Tamim Bin Hamad Al-Thani of Qatar, discussing the need to protect civilians and increase humanitarian assistance in Gaza. Biden welcomed Qatar's $100 million commitment and expressed appreciation for their efforts in securing the release of hostages, including two American citizens. He condemned Hamas for holding hostages, including a 3-year-old American toddler, and emphasized the importance of their release. Both leaders agreed to work towards a peaceful and stable Middle East region.
